“Даже если у вас есть только идея — мы поможем вам получить результат, о котором вы мечтали.”

Артём Богомазов
основатель компании
Россия, г. Белгород,
Свято-Троицкий бульвар, д.17, оф. 503
Карточка организации

основатель компании
Сайты объявлений повсюду: на них продают вещи, ищут услуги, отдают питомцев и даже ищут соседей по квартире. Кажется, что ничего сложного — разместил форму, сделал список, и готово. Но под внешней простотой скрывается множество нюансов: архитектура, удобство поиска, борьба со спамом, монетизация, соответствие законам. В этой статье я постараюсь пройти с вами весь путь от идеи до запуска, объяснить ключевые технические и продуктовые решения и показать, как избежать типичных ошибок.
Если вы думаете о создании собственной площадки для объявлений — держите эту статью как карту. Я расскажу, какие функции действительно нужны, какие технологии стоит рассматривать, как выстроить работу команды и как подготовить проект к росту. Здесь нет пустых рассуждений — только практические советы и реальные варианты решений.
Первое, что нужно понять — для кого вы делаете проект. Объявления могут быть локальными — для города или района, или глобальными — с охватом всей страны. От ответа на этот вопрос зависят функциональные требования, масштаб и затраты на продвижение. Нужен ответ: кого вы хотите привлечь и какую проблему решаете.
Пользователь приходит на сайт объявлений ради простоты и скорости. Если вы дадите удобный поиск, релевантные результаты и быстрое общение между продавцом и покупателем, у вас есть шанс вытеснить конкурентов. Но если интерфейс запутан, регистрации много, а объявления редкие — пользователи уйдут сразу.
Не все сайты объявлений одинаковы. Существуют разные бизнес-модели, и выбор влияет на архитектуру и набор функций. Прежде чем писать код, стоит выбрать модель и описать сценарии использования.
Ниже перечислены популярные модели и их отличия. Каждая из них предполагает разные требования к функционалу и монетизации.
Классический вариант удобен для старта: низкий порог входа для пользователей и простая техническая реализация. Маркетплейс требует больше доверия и механизмов защиты, но дает стабильный доход от транзакций. Нишевая площадка выигрывает в целевой аудитории и высокой конверсии, если вы хорошо знаете рынок. Комьюнити-платформа требует модерации и активности пользователей, зато удержание выше.
Выбор модели часто диктует не только бизнес-логику, но и набор обязанностей команды. Например, маркетплейсу потребуются менеджеры по работе с продавцами и служба поддержки транзакций, а нишевому проекту — эксперты по контенту и SEO.
Создавая сайт объявлений, разумно разделять функции на обязательные для запуска, и те, которые можно добавить позже. Минимальный набор помогает быстрее выйти на рынок и проверить гипотезы.
Ниже — список базового функционала, который необходим для MVP, и расширенные возможности, которые повышают ценность площадки.
Этот минимум позволяет пользователям размещать и находить объявления, а вам — оценить спрос и поведение аудитории. Важно, чтобы интерфейс был интуитивным, а процесс создания объявления — быстрым.
Эти функции увеличивают вовлеченность и доход. Но важно внедрять их по приоритету — сначала те, что влияют на конверсию.
Пользовательский опыт решает успех площадки. Даже если у вас лучший алгоритм поиска, плохой интерфейс сведет всё на нет. Люди любят ясность: где разместить объявление, как искать, как связаться — эти пути должны быть очевидны.
Фокусируйтесь на двух вещах: скорость и простота. Сократите шаги при публикации, предложите шаблоны для описания и инструмент для загрузки фото. Делайте так, чтобы ключевые действия выполнялись в один-два клика.
Карточка объявления — сердце площадки. Она должна содержать фото, заголовок, цену, местоположение, контактную информацию и кнопку действия. Также полезно показывать метки - "новое", "проверено", "срочно". Эти элементы повышают доверие и помогают пользователю принять решение.
Детали важны: качественные фотографии, корректная сортировка по дате и релевантности, отзывчивый дизайн для мобильных — всё это не роскошь, а необходимость.
Поиск должен давать релевантные результаты даже при опечатках. Подумайте о подсказках во время ввода, автодополнении и сохранении частых запросов. Фильтры — это то, что превращает браузера в покупателя; расположите их так, чтобы они не мешали просмотру, но были всегда под рукой.
Используйте простые фильтры сначала — категория, цена, местоположение — а затем добавляйте дополнительные по мере роста площадки. Нагружать интерфейс слишком большим количеством настроек не стоит.
Выбор технологий зависит от ваших целей. Если нужен быстрый запуск, можно взять фреймворк с готовыми компонентами. Если важна масштабируемость и производительность, подход будет другим. Я приведу варианты для разных сценариев и перечислю их плюсы и минусы.
Ниже — таблица с популярными решениями по фронтенду, бэкенду, поиску и базам данных.
| Слой | Варианты | Плюсы | Минусы |
|---|---|---|---|
| Фронтенд | React, Vue, Svelte | Большие экосистемы, компоненты, быстрая реакция интерфейса | Нужна сборка, возможна сложность для SEO без SSR |
| Бэкенд | Node.js, Django, Ruby on Rails, Laravel | Быстрая разработка, готовые библиотеки, широкая поддержка | Для высокой нагрузки нужны оптимизации и грамотный масштаб |
| Поиск | Elasticsearch, Algolia, PostgreSQL full-text | Скорость поиска, синонимы, подсказки | Дополнительная настройка и индексация, стоимость |
| База данных | PostgreSQL, MySQL, MongoDB | Надежные, транзакции, гибкость схем | Нужна правильная схема и индексация для скорости |
| Хранение файлов | AWS S3, Google Cloud Storage, локальное хранение | Масштабируемость, CDN для фото | Стоимость хранения и трафика |
Для MVP часто используют связку React или Vue на фронтенде и Node.js или Django на бэкенде. PostgreSQL подходит как основная база, а для поиска можно начать с PostgreSQL full-text, а затем подключить Elasticsearch или Algolia, если понадобится масштаб.
Хранение фотографий лучше сразу вынести в облачное хранилище и подключить CDN. Это снизит нагрузку на сервер и улучшит время загрузки страницы для пользователей.
Даже если вы стартуете с небольшой аудитории, закладывайте архитектуру, которую можно масштабировать. Понятные границы между сервисами, асинхронная обработка задач и корректная индексация данных помогут выдержать рост трафика.
Используйте очереди задач для обработки фото, отправки писем и расчёта рейтингов. Это разгрузит основной поток запросов и сделает систему устойчивее. Горизонтальное масштабирование — ваш друг: дубляйте веб-серверы, используйте балансировщик и масштабируемую СУБД.
Типичный набросок: фронтенд (SPA или SSR), API-сервер, база данных, сервис поиска, очередь задач и объектное хранилище для файлов. Между компонентами — четкие API. Такой подход позволяет заменить или масштабировать любую часть без полного рефакторинга.
Подумайте о мониторинге с самого начала. Логи, метрики и алерты помогут быстро реагировать на сбои и узкие места производительности.
Сайты объявлений особенно уязвимы для фродеров и спамеров. Нужны как автоматические, так и ручные механизмы фильтрации. Не стоит полагаться только на CAPTCHAs — они раздражают пользователей и часто обходятся.
Сочетайте проверку контента с анализом поведения: частые публикации с одного IP, одинаковые тексты, подозрительные ссылки — всё это сигналы. Используйте фильтры на стороне сервера и внешние сервисы для детекции спама.
Не забывайте о защите платежей: интегрируйте проверенные платёжные шлюзы, используйте HTTPS везде и храните минимально возможный набор данных на своей стороне.
Есть несколько проверенных способов монетизации площадок объявлений. Часто лучшая стратегия — комбинировать несколько источников дохода и адаптировать их после анализа рынка.
Ниже — перечисление распространённых опций и рекомендации по внедрению.
При выборе модели важно не испортить пользовательский опыт. Например, слишком агрессивное продвижение объявлений вредит доверю. Пробуйте и тестируйте, вводя платные функции аккуратно и с прозрачными условиями.
Объявления по своей природе зависят от поискового трафика. Люди часто ищут товары и услуги через поисковики, поэтому правильная SEO-оптимизация — ключ к стабильному притоку пользователей без постоянных затрат на рекламу.
Главная задача — убедиться, что карточки объявлений индексируются и приносят целевой трафик. Для этого нужны понятные URL, уникальные заголовки, мета-теги и структурированные данные.
Акции и спецпроекты с блогами и партнёрами помогут получить начальный приток. Не забывайте работать с рефералами и локальными сообществами — для местных площадок это часто самый эффективный канал.
Чтобы понимать, как развивается проект, определите ключевые метрики и следите за ними с первых дней. Данные расскажут, что работает, а что нет, и куда инвестировать усилия.
Какие метрики важны для площадки объявлений? Рассмотрим основные.
| Метрика | Зачем нужна | Как улучшать |
|---|---|---|
| DAU/MAU | Оценивает активность пользователей | Улучшение UX, уведомления, персонализация |
| Конверсия публикаций | Процент пользователей, разместивших объявление | Упростить форму, предзаполнение, подсказки |
| CTR объявлений | Насколько объявления привлекают внимание | Качество фото, заголовков, релевантность |
| Средний доход с пользователя | Выручка на одного активного пользователя | Монетизация, кросс-продажи, подписки |
| Retention | Удержание пользователей после первого визита | Уведомления, персональные рекомендации, сервис |
Аналитика должна быть доступной для команды продукта. Регулярные отчёты и дашборды помогают принимать решения быстрее и на основе реальных данных.
Разработка сайта объявлений — это не только код. Это дизайн, продуктовая работа, тестирование, маркетинг и поддержка. Ниже я опишу типичный пошаговый процесс с примерными сроками для минимальной версии проекта.
Подчеркну: сроки зависят от команды и требований. Приведённый пример — ориентир, а не закон.
| Этап | Что включено | Примерная длительность |
|---|---|---|
| Исследование и продукт | Анализ рынка, целевой аудитории, определение MVP | 1–2 недели |
| Дизайн | Прототипы, UX, визуальный дизайн | 2–4 недели |
| Разработка MVP | Фронтенд, API, БД, базовая модерация | 6–12 недель |
| Тестирование | Функциональные и нагрузочные тесты | 1–3 недели |
| Запуск и маркетинг | Пилотный запуск, первые рекламные кампании | 2–4 недели |
Важно запускаться с небольшим, но работающим функционалом. Реальные пользователи подскажут, что стоит развивать в первую очередь.
После релиза проект не заканчивается. Это только начало. Пользователи будут сообщать о багах, предлагать улучшения, и требовать новых функций. Чем быстрее вы будете реагировать, тем выше шанс удержать аудиторию.
Организуйте процессы: регистрируйте инциденты, приоритизируйте задачи по ROI и работайте над видимыми улучшениями в первую очередь. Частые, но небольшие обновления лучше одного большого релиза раз в полгода.
Для стабильной работы и развития площадки обычно требуется базовый состав: продакт-менеджер, дизайнер, пара разработчиков (фронтенд и бэкенд), QA-инженер и специалист по маркетингу. Для масштабов выше нужны DevOps, аналитик и служба поддержки.
Часто на старте одну роль выполняет один человек. Главное — четко понимать зоны ответственности и иметь процесс коммуникации.
Сайты объявлений обрабатывают персональные данные и иногда участвуют в коммерческих сделках. Нужно заранее продумать политику конфиденциальности, правила использования и механизм обработки жалоб. Это важно для доверия пользователей и для соблюдения законодательства.
Если вы планируете работать с платежами, подготовьтесь к требованиям к бухгалтерии и возможным спорам между продавцами и покупателями. Наличие прозрачных условий возврата и процедур разрешения конфликтов снизит риски.
Рекомендуется проконсультироваться с юристом, особенно если вы планируете масштабироваться в другие регионы или работать с финансовыми операциями.
Ниже — краткий чеклист того, что нужно обязательно проверить перед запуском площадки. Ничего лишнего, только практичные пункты.
Из опыта видно, что многие нишевые площадки выигрывают за счёт глубокого понимания своего сегмента. Успех приходит не только от технологии, но и от того, насколько вы умеете работать с продавцами и поддерживать качество объявлений.
Классические ошибки: слишком сложный процесс публикации, навязывание платных функций на старте, отсутствие локального продвижения и игнорирование мобильных пользователей. Эти промахи убивают рост быстрее, чем технические сбои.
Когда проект делает ставку на простоту и локальную активность — он набирает обороты. Например, площадки, которые помогали продавцам с фотосъёмкой и написанием текстов, часто получали больше качественных объявлений и выше удержание. Ещё один верный ход — организация оффлайн-событий или партнёрств с локальным бизнесом для привлечения первых пользователей.
Такие методы дороже в первые месяцы, но дают прочный фундамент и доверие аудитории.
Разработка сайта объявлений — задача с множеством переменных. Главное — понять аудиторию, начать с минимального набора функций и быстро итеративно улучшать продукт. Тщательно продумайте UX, защиту от спама и пути монетизации.
Если суммировать в короткий план действий: определите модель, опишите MVP, соберите маленькую команду, запустите и активно работайте с пользователями. Данные и обратная связь помогут решить, какие функции вводить следующими.
Если вы готовы — начинайте с маленьких шагов. Рынок объявлений открыт для тех, кто умеет сделать сервис проще и полезнее для людей.
Надеюсь, эта статья дала вам ясную карту и практические ориентиры. Важно не застревать в планах: тестируйте идеи быстрее, чем тратите ресурсы на то, что может оказаться неактуальным.
Удачи в разработке — и пусть ваша площадка станет местом, где люди быстро находят нужные вещи и добросовестных продавцов.
Отправляя данную форму, Вы подтверждаете согласие на обработку персональных данных в соответствии с Федеральным законом № 152-ФЗ «О персональных данных» от 27.07.2006, Политикой конфиденциальности и Обработке персональных данных.